Thanks to the delta variant, Bay Area coronavirus cases are rising yet again, just six weeks after California's big reopening. But this is a different kind of surge with very different lessons, says Chronicle health reporter Erin Allday. She tells host Demian Bulwa why the latest case rates may be a flawed measurement, and talks about what we need to know about breakthrough infections and booster shots.
